The building operated for a long time to transform energy and transmit it to the heart of the city, and for over three decades it has been in a state of suspension, impermeable to the vitality of the surrounding environment, waiting for a new identity. The structure has hidden its spatial articulation, waiting to be reconverted to new needs by the non-profit association Re-Use With Love, winner of the redevelopment tender: in a regeneration process that will maintain the memory of the building's industrial past but will generate a new memory for all those who will cross it and use its spaces. A translation respectful of tradition; a metamorphosis that combines origins with the present.

The architectural project has adopted specific strategies aimed at reconnecting the building to the context of the Park through the opening of an entrance on the south front, reachable from Viale Stenio Polischi through a new paved pedestrian path. All the original acoustic grilles have been removed and the openings resized to become large glazed windows, capable of transmitting natural light to the underlying rooms. To overcome the difference in level between the park and the internal mezzanine, a wooden platform has been built with a staircase and a gentle ramp, to allow access to all. This last element is conceived not only as a connection tool but also as a permanent furniture, being equipped with linear seating facing the Park.
The project maintains and enhances the current entrance of the Power Plant, located at the level of Viale Giovanni Gozzadini, which, while maintaining the geometries of the original iron portal, becomes a glazed infill together with the peculiar existing circular openings. The increased contribution of natural lighting and ventilation, the efficiency of the building envelope, and the installation of radiant floors will allow for consumption control and greater internal comfort for users.
In its entirety, the architectural intervention is characterized by restoration and rehabilitation actions of the existing structures, as well as structural interventions aimed at improving safety conditions, but also by the introduction of new elements, which interpret the changed needs by approaching the industrial past of the building with their materiality and finish. An ideal dialogue between the original technical elements restored, such as the electrical insulators hung from the high ceilings of the power plant, the new project surfaces, and the new lighting bodies; between the walls that show the signs of structural rehabilitation and the new metal elements that surround the openings. Seeing the invisible, grasping the constitutive nature of things, is the conceptual reason that links the path of CONTROLUCE, a team of professionals with multiple and complementary skills that aims to decline Architecture at different scales and in its most varied expressions. The team is dedicated in particular to architectural and urban design, working in both public and private sectors with a particular attention to environmental and social sustainability. Among the main works carried out, the following should be mentioned: The redevelopment of the former Enel power plant in the Giardini Margherita park in Bologna; The design of the new "Le Badie" School Complex in Castellina Marittima; The final-executive project for the redevelopment and re-functionalization of the former Church of the Piarist Fathers in Pieve di Cento; The final-executive project for the restructuring of the "Casa per anziani" and the socio-healthcare center in Castel D'Aiano
